Anna Lamb 1769 – 1852 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 8 November 1769

Birth Location: Amenia, Dutchess, New York, United States

Death Date: 3 September 1852

Death Location: Bolton, Warren County, New York, USA

Father: David Lamb

Mother: Elizabeth Gates

Spouse(s): Daniel Beswick

Children(s): Elizabeth Beswick

In 1769, Anna Lamb entered the world in Amenia, Dutchess, New York, United States, born to David F Lamb and Elizabeth Gates. Anna Lamb married Daniel Beswick, and had children including Elizabeth Beswick. Anna Lamb passed away in 1852 in Bolton, Warren County, New York, USA.
